Day 6 — Udawalawe → Ussangoda → Rumassala → Bentota
Key Sites:
Red-earth plateau where folklore says Ravana landed the Pushpaka Vimana / area scorched by Hanuman. Scenic and culturally significant.
Tied to the Sanjeevani legend—part of the mountain Hanuman carried that fell here; herbal lore & temple on the headland, superb ocean views.
The story of the Galle Dutch Fort; a UNESCO World Heritage Site reverberates through every traveler’s photo and caption. Initially built by the Portuguese in the 16th century during their conquests, the fort was later fortified and conquered by the Dutch in the 17th century, until it later fell to the might of the British. The oldest library of the country is also in the Galle fort.

Day 7 — Bentota → Colombo
Key Sites:
Tradition says Vibhishana (Ravana’s brother) was crowned here after the war—frequently included on Ramayana programs.]
A modern Hindu Temple dedicated to Lord Hanuman, uniquely featuring a five-faced image & Sri Lanka’s only Hanuman Temple with a ceremonial chariot
